G2950Greekkýmbalon

κύμβαλον

a "cymbal" (as hollow)

Detailed Definition

  • 1a cymbal, i.e., a hollow basin of brass, producing when struck together a musical sound

Etymology & Derivation

from a derivative of the base of g2949
